Jean G. (Gonsalves) Tolman, age 91, of Norwell, passed away peacefully on March 28, 2017. Beloved wife of the late Arthur M. Tolman, whom she married on Jan. 8, 1949. Devoted mother of Maria J. Tolman and Theodore A. Tolman, both of Norwell. Eldest sister of Edward J. Gonsalves and wife Janet of Weymouth, the late Joanne Mispel, Alfred Gonsalves Jr., Joseph Gonsalves, Carol Gonsalves, George Gonsalves and James Gonsalves. Close sister in law of Shirley Tolman of Plympton. "Adopted" Grandmother of Taryn Bourke, Amanda Reardon, and Kaley DeBoer. Also survived by many nieces and nephews.
A graduate of Cohasset High School, Class of 1943, Jean worked at the Hingham Shipyard during WWII and later Factory Mutual, where she typed engineering reports. After having kids, Jean raised her family. She returned to work for 25 years for the Town of Norwell School Department, where she served an average 300 kids per year, almost daily, as well as assisting with cooking for senior citizens. Jean also volunteered as the secretary for the Norwell Senior Citizens. She was a member of the First Parish Church and later a member of the Church Hill Methodist Church. She was on the W.S.C.S. and helped serve church suppers. Jean loved spending her summers at the family camp in Brewster on Cape Cod.
